Abstract

A discrete-time model is established to show the transmission of malaria between humans and mosquitoes with the incubation periods of parasites within both human and mosquito concerned. It is proved that the disease free equilibrium of the model is globally asymptotically stable when the basic reproduction number is less than 1 by constructing appropriate Lyapunov functions.
